SSBM Decomp
Loading...
Searching...
No Matches
ftwalkcommon.c File Reference
#include "ftwalkcommon.h"
#include "fighter.h"
#include "ft_081B.h"
#include "ftcommon.h"
#include "math.h"
#include "ft/forward.h"
#include "ft/ftanim.h"
#include "ft/types.h"
#include "ftCommon/forward.h"
#include "ftCommon/types.h"
#include <baselib/forward.h>
#include <dolphin/mtx.h>
#include <dolphin/os/OSError.h>
#include <baselib/debug.h>

Functions

FtWalkType ftWalkCommon_GetWalkType (HSD_GObj *gobj)
static FtWalkType ftWalkCommon_GetWalkType_800DFBF8_fake (HSD_GObj *gobj)
bool ftWalkCommon_800DFC70 (HSD_GObj *gobj)
void ftWalkCommon_800DFCA4 (Fighter_GObj *gobj, FtMotionId msid, MotionFlags ms_flags, float anim_start, float slow_anim_frame, float middle_anim_frame, float fast_anim_frame, float slow_anim_rate, float middle_anim_rate, float fast_anim_rate, float accel_mul)
void ftWalkCommon_800DFDDC (HSD_GObj *gobj)
void ftWalkCommon_800DFEC8 (HSD_GObj *gobj, void(*arg_cb)(HSD_GObj *, float))
static float getWalkAccel (Fighter *fp, float mul)
void ftWalkCommon_800E0060 (HSD_GObj *gobj)

Function Documentation

◆ ftWalkCommon_GetWalkType()

FtWalkType ftWalkCommon_GetWalkType ( HSD_GObj * gobj)

◆ ftWalkCommon_GetWalkType_800DFBF8_fake()

FtWalkType ftWalkCommon_GetWalkType_800DFBF8_fake ( HSD_GObj * gobj)
inlinestatic

◆ ftWalkCommon_800DFC70()

bool ftWalkCommon_800DFC70 ( HSD_GObj * gobj)

◆ ftWalkCommon_800DFCA4()

void ftWalkCommon_800DFCA4 ( Fighter_GObj * gobj,
FtMotionId msid,
MotionFlags ms_flags,
float anim_start,
float slow_anim_frame,
float middle_anim_frame,
float fast_anim_frame,
float slow_anim_rate,
float middle_anim_rate,
float fast_anim_rate,
float accel_mul )

◆ ftWalkCommon_800DFDDC()

void ftWalkCommon_800DFDDC ( HSD_GObj * gobj)

◆ ftWalkCommon_800DFEC8()

void ftWalkCommon_800DFEC8 ( HSD_GObj * gobj,
void(* arg_cb )(HSD_GObj *, float) )

◆ getWalkAccel()

float getWalkAccel ( Fighter * fp,
float mul )
static

◆ ftWalkCommon_800E0060()

void ftWalkCommon_800E0060 ( HSD_GObj * gobj)